German Shepherd
German Shepherd puppies are bright, curious, and quick to test rules, especially when they sense hesitation. They thrive on structure and clear, consistent feedback, or they will invent their own agenda.
Channel that brainpower early with short, upbeat sessions and plenty of problem-solving games.
As boundaries become routine, you will see an incredible switch flip. The same pup that nudged limits becomes your focused shadow, reading your body language like a second language.
Loyalty runs deep here, often paired with calm confidence that feels like steady companionship.
Socialization is everything for a well-rounded guardian. Expose them to people, places, and sounds, and reward neutrality.
Do that, and you will earn a partner that works with heart and listens with devotion.
Rottweiler
Rottweiler puppies often push boundaries with confident play and strong opinions. They love clarity, routine, and purposeful jobs that help them understand where they fit.
Without structure, they can become mouthy or overexcited, so consistent reinforcement and calm leadership are key.
Give them early obedience, leash manners, and impulse control games, and watch their potential bloom. They bond intensely when they trust your guidance, offering a steady presence that feels like a velvet hammer.
Their protective instincts are powerful, but with socialization, they remain composed.
Rotties adore working for you, especially with food or tug rewards. Keep sessions brief, upbeat, and fair.
When you invest now, you earn a dog that chooses you every time and stands firm by your side.
Doberman Pinscher
Doberman puppies are sharp, sensitive, and quick to challenge vague rules. They read emotions well, so inconsistent responses can create anxiety or pushback.
A thoughtful plan with clear markers, reward timing, and decompression breaks turns a whirlwind into a polished partner.
They do best when they have meaningful connection and daily mental tasks. Confidence grows with pattern games, place training, and recall that feels like a fun routine.
Early socialization builds neutrality so protective instincts develop with balanced judgment.
Dobermans become velcro-level loyal when communication is respectful and predictable. Keep training upbeat, never harsh, and celebrate small wins.
Soon you will have a sleek, attentive companion who checks in constantly and chooses cooperation because it feels safe and rewarding.
Cane Corso
Cane Corso puppies can be willful and physically bold, testing limits through size and presence. Early boundaries are non negotiable, but they should feel fair and consistent, never reactive.
Introduce leash skills, impulse control, and calm exposure to new environments from day one.
This breed thrives when life has routines and clear household rules. When expectations are steady, their natural confidence funnels into composure.
Socialization should prioritize neutrality and polite observation rather than nonstop greetings.
With patient guidance, a Corso becomes impossibly devoted, often forming a steady, watchful bond. They want to work for you, not against you.
Invest in calm leadership and purposeful training, and you will gain a stalwart guardian whose loyalty feels unshakeable and sincere.
Boxer
Boxer puppies are clowns with motors that do not quit. They test limits through exuberance, jumping, and impulsive choices when excitement spikes.
Redirect that spark into play based training, short drills, and sniffy decompression walks to dial down the chaos.
They are people focused and learn fast when rewards flow freely. Teach clear off switches like mat training and settle after play.
Socialization should be upbeat but structured, preventing rehearsal of rude greetings.
With patience, their goofy bravado turns into honest devotion. Boxers mature into energetic, family minded partners who will happily do anything with you.
Keep routines predictable, celebrate calmer choices, and that boundless energy transforms into joyful loyalty that brightens every single day.
Labrador Retriever
Labrador puppies often test boundaries by grabbing everything, greeting everyone, and believing rules are optional. They are food motivated, so channel curiosity into structured games and productive chewing.
Teach leave it, drop, and calm greetings early to keep manners on track.
Labs thrive with consistent exercise, sniffing, and simple jobs like carrying or targeting. Mental outlets reduce mischief and prevent rehearsed chaos.
Socialization should include quiet observation so they learn that stillness pays too.
As routines settle, their sunny nature hardens into unwavering loyalty. A well trained Lab will match your pace, check in often, and treat your voice like the north star.
Keep it positive and predictable, and you will have a devoted, joyful companion for every adventure.
Golden Retriever
Golden Retriever puppies can test you with jumpy greetings, mouthy play, and selective listening when excitement surges. Their biddable nature shines with kind, consistent training built on food, toys, and praise.
Teach impulse control and settle cues to help their sweet brain slow down.
Goldens love patterns and predictability, making routine your secret weapon. Early exposure to different environments builds confidence without flooding.
Shape calm behaviors around doors, guests, and meal times to prevent pushy habits.
That golden heart becomes fierce in its gentleness as they mature. They bond deeply and seek to understand you, mirroring your tone and pace.
With patient guidance, the playful tester becomes your steadfast friend who loves hard and stays close.
Australian Shepherd
Australian Shepherd puppies are clever whirlwinds that test limits by inventing jobs, often herding ankles or chasing motion. Give their brains puzzles, trick training, and scent games or they will freelance.
Structure, movement, and decompression time keep arousal from boiling over.
Teach cooperative skills like leash neutrality, recall, and place to build impulse control. Rotate enrichment to satisfy their need for novelty without chaos.
Socialization should include calm observation so they learn to choose stillness.
When guided well, Aussies become fiercely loyal partners that anticipate needs and love teamwork. They live for shared projects, whether hiking, obedience, or frisbee.
Honoring their mind with fair boundaries transforms boundary testing into brilliant, heart-forward devotion.
Belgian Malinois
Belgian Malinois puppies arrive wired for work and will test gaps in any plan. Without outlets, they invent adrenaline hobbies you will not enjoy.
Use structured bite work alternatives, tug games with rules, and place training to harness that drive.
Clarity and timing matter more than volume. Keep sessions short, high value, and frequent, paired with decompression walks.
Socialization should emphasize neutrality and disengagement over constant interaction.
When their engine points the right way, loyalty is breathtaking. They watch you like a hawk, cueing off micro-movements and tone.
With fair structure and consistent expectations, the pushy puppy becomes a precise, devoted partner that chooses teamwork over chaos every single day.
Rhodesian Ridgeback
Rhodesian Ridgeback puppies can be independent thinkers that question every rule. They are sensitive to pressure, so heavy-handed approaches backfire.
Use calm structure, clear boundaries, and high-value rewards to make cooperation worth their while.
They respond beautifully to routines and fair choices, like earned freedom after focus. Socialization should prioritize polite neutrality and resilience in new places.
Encourage recall through fun chases and games that respect their hunting heritage.
With steady guidance, Ridgebacks mature into loyal, dignified companions who choose closeness on their terms. That autonomy, when paired with trust, creates unshakable devotion.
Respect their nature, train with patience, and you will have a guardian that watches quietly yet stands firm when needed.
